Select the start sniffing button on the toolbar or,Start Sniffing on the BPA 500 menu. 2. The pairing process between the devices begins. As data is being captured, the Status message at the top of the window indicates the synchronization status of the ComProbe analyzer. Also, the color of the ComProbe icon changes depending on the synchronization state. There are four states: Table 4.1 - BPA 500 LED Capture Indicators LED Color Description Red = Halted/Pending Green = Waiting for the master to connect to the slave Blue = Synchronized with the master clock — link active Grey = Synchronized with the master clock — link inactive Yellow = Waiting for the master to resume transmission - 58 -
